Subject: My hair
My hair, the way it grows naturally from my head, is neither "extreme" nor a "fad." It requires neither heat nor chemicals to be professional or beautiful. When is the last time a straight-haired blonde was asked to permanently alter her tresses to gain acceptance in the workplace? Ponder that and watch this video.
